What Are All-on-6 Dental Implants?
All-on-6 is a full-arch restoration system. Six titanium implants are placed into the jawbone of one arch, upper, lower, or both, and act as anchors for a fixed bridge that replaces every tooth on that arch.
The term “fixed” matters here. All-on-6 is not a denture. The bridge is permanently attached to the implants and cannot be removed by the patient. It looks, feels, and functions like natural teeth. You eat with it, clean it like natural teeth, and sleep with it in place.
The implants themselves are small titanium posts that fuse with the jawbone over a period of three to six months in a process called osseointegration. Once this is complete, the bone treats the implants as part of its own structure. This is what makes All-on-6 a long-term solution rather than a prosthetic appliance.
All-on-6 is typically recommended for patients who have lost most or all of their teeth on one arch due to decay, gum disease, fracture, or failed previous dental work. If both arches need restoration, two separate procedures are planned, one per arch.
All-on-6 vs All-on-4: Which Is Right for You?
Both procedures restore a full arch of teeth using implants. The difference lies in the number of implants, the placement approach, and the candidacy requirements.
All-on-4 uses four implants per arch. Two are placed straight at the front, and two are angled at the back to take advantage of available bone in the anterior jaw. This angled placement means All-on-4 can work in patients with reduced bone density in the rear of the jaw, patients who might otherwise need a bone graft before implants can be placed.
All-on-6 uses six implants, distributed more evenly across the arch. This wider distribution means biting force is spread across six points rather than four, and if one implant ever requires attention over time, the remaining five continue to support the bridge.
| Factor | All-on-4 | All-on-6 |
|---|---|---|
| Implants per arch | 4 | 6 |
| Placement approach | 2 straight, 2 angled | Distributed across arch |
| Bone volume required | Lower, angled design compensates | Higher, adequate bone needed |
| Force distribution | Good | Better, across 6 points |
| Redundancy if one implant fails | Lower | Higher |
| Cost | Lower | Higher |
| Best suited for | Reduced bone volume | Good bone volume; stronger long-term support |
Neither procedure is categorically better. All-on-4 was specifically designed for patients with reduced bone volume, and it delivers excellent results in the right clinical situation. All-on-6 is the preferred option when bone volume is adequate and the patient wants maximum force distribution and long-term resilience.

Who Is a Candidate for All-on-6 in Antalya?
All-on-6 is appropriate for most patients who have lost most or all teeth on one arch and have adequate bone volume to support six implants. More specifically:
Good candidates typically have:
– Missing most or all teeth on the upper arch, lower arch, or both
– Sufficient jawbone volume assessed via panoramic X-ray
– Good general health, no uncontrolled systemic conditions
– Non-smoker status, or a firm commitment to stop smoking during osseointegration
– Realistic expectations about the two-trip timeline and 3–6 month healing period
All-on-6 may not be appropriate if you have:
– Insufficient bone volume, in some cases, a bone graft can resolve this, though it adds cost and extends the treatment timeline; in others, All-on-4 is the more practical route
– Uncontrolled diabetes, this significantly affects implant integration and healing
– Active gum disease, must be treated before implants are placed
– Certain blood-thinning medications, these require careful assessment and may need to be paused with your GP’s guidance
– An active smoking habit, smoking is the single biggest preventable risk factor for implant failure; our dental team will be direct about this

Acrylic vs Zirconia: What Prosthesis Will You Leave With?
All-on-6 treatment involves two different prostheses at different stages of treatment.
The temporary bridge (Trip 1) is made from acrylic resin. It is fitted where bone quality and implant primary stability allow — our dental team confirms this on Day 1. It gives you functional teeth during the osseointegration period. It is not the final restoration.
The permanent bridge (Trip 2) is made from zirconia, a ceramic material that is significantly stronger, more durable, and more aesthetically natural than acrylic. Zirconia is stain-resistant, does not absorb odour, and has a translucency that closely mimics natural tooth enamel.
The zirconia bridge fitted at Trip 2 is the restoration you will be living with long-term. Most patients notice a significant difference in both aesthetics and comfort compared to the temporary bridge. If you are comparing quotes between clinics, confirm what material is used for the permanent bridge, acrylic and zirconia differ considerably in quality and price.
How Long Do All-on-6 Implants Last?
The titanium implants themselves have an indefinite lifespan when properly maintained and when osseointegration is fully achieved. Published clinical literature reports implant survival rates above 95% at ten years, with long-term studies extending to 15 and 20 years showing strong outcomes.
The zirconia bridge is designed to last 15–25 years. Like natural teeth, it requires regular cleaning and occasional professional maintenance.
Factors that affect long-term success include:
- Oral hygiene, the gum tissue around implants is susceptible to peri-implantitis (implant-related gum disease) if cleaning is inadequate; twice-daily brushing and interdental cleaning are essential
- Smoking, the most significant preventable risk factor for implant failure; patients who smoke post-placement have measurably lower long-term success rates
- Bone health, conditions that affect bone density, including certain medications and systemic diseases, can influence long-term outcomes
- Bite forces, patients who grind or clench should discuss whether a night guard is advisable to protect the bridge
